RISCAuthority launch Escape of Water Guidance
Escape of water (EoW) events can displace people from their homes, incur great disruption, significant property damage, financial cost and, in some instances even lead to businesses failing. Poorly designed and installed systems can also lead to serious personal injury and death.
This first edition of the ‘Approved Document G incorporating insurers’ requirements’ seeks to enhance site practices and reinforces what should already be happening by collating pertinent Regulations and guidance in a single document that is freely available.
Protector's Fleet Risk Management Academy
After the successful delivery of Module 1 to specific motor fleet clients we have decided to upload and share the course on our brand new website.
Module 1 offers an introduction to the wider fleet risk programme focusing on, risk factors by road type, incident reporting, suitable & sufficient risk assessment, policy development and how effective leadership can improve driver safety performance.
